    Glen Greenwald's partner detained at London airport

    Greenwald is the guy who's been doing a lot of reporting on Snowden's NSA whistleblowing. They detained his partner for several hours on the grounds of questioning him about terrorist ties, but instead grilled him on the NSA reporting Greenwald is doing for the Guardian.

    They also confiscated all of his electronic equipment, including his mobile phone, laptop computer, camera, memory sticks, DVDs and game consoles.

    And to add to the alarm that this should generate, over 97 percent of interrogations under Schedule 7 last less than one hour. One in 2,000 people retained are kept for more than six hours. Miranda was kept for the full nine.

    The House of Commons is in recess, so they can't be questioned there, but the UK government need to answer for this.
